STEP 2:

Prepare The Venting System

Standard Fittings

NOTE:

If the existing duct is round, you must use a rectangular-to-round adapter, with a rectangular 3" extension

duct installed between the damper assembly and the adapter to prevent the exhaust damper’s sticking.

Duct Length

The total length of the duct system, including straight duct, elbows, transitions, and wall or roof caps 

must not

exceed 140 feet.

For best performance, do not use more than three 90 degree elbows, and keep the length as short as possible.

Below are the standard fittings and their equivalent length in feet.

To calculate the equivalent length of each duct piece used, see the examples below.
